WebSep 16, 2024 · 3. Leave your clothing to soak for 1 hour and then wash it. After you’ve rubbed the majority of the stain away, let your clothing sit in the sink for 1 hour. This will give the lemon juice and water time to loosen up any remaining residue from the sweat stain. Then, throw your clothing in with the rest of your laundry. WebOct 25, 2024 · Removing Blood Stains With Baking Soda Rub Baking Soda Paste on Stain Rub a baking soda paste onto a damp blood stain with your fingers or an old toothbrush. Wait and Wash as Usual Allow the paste to sit for up to an hour to help lift the stain from the fabric. Wash per the care label instructions. Removing Sweat Stains With Baking Soda

WebJan 11, 2024 · Mix the cleaner with warm water and soak the shirt for 30 minutes. Older coffee stains are more stubborn, but you can definitely get them out! Mix 1 quart (946 ml) of warm water with 1 tablespoon (15 ml) of an enzymatic presoak product in a large basin or bucket. Then, immerse the shirt in the solution.
